All you need to know about Dan Croll

GP checks in with British singer Dan Croll, 26, about why he decided to give his phone number out and set up a helpline for fans. For more information about Dial Dan, whose lines reopen today, visit dancroll.com
What was the thinking behind Dial Dan?
My latest single Away From Today (out now) is about stepping away from what you’re doing. I wanted to give my fans a direct line to me, so they could escape/chat for as long as they wanted to.
Did you take any particularly difficult calls?
One of the more shocking calls was from a girl from Tel Aviv. She had been offered her dream job in another country and was thinking about taking it, but was worried about a rise in hate crime there due to the developments of right-wing political parties. She had large Star of David tattoos on each wrist and was having to think about hiding her own personal beliefs. It hit me pretty hard.
What is your best form of therapy?
Exercise — it’s easy for me to get bogged down in a studio or on the road so I tend to jump at every chance to go outside.
You’ve crossed paths with Sir Paul McCartney in the past. What surprised you the most about him?
The amount of times he would say ‘groovy’ in a sentence was quite surprising!
Can you single out the most rock’n’roll moment from your career so far?
That I get to travel the world, play to a lot of people, make records and live off music. Less booze, drugs and name dropping than most artists, but there’s still time…
